35 * Function for registering the binding
37 * A binding V1 MUST have an exported function of name
39 * afbBindingV1Register
41 * This function is called during loading of the binding. It
42 * receives an 'interface' that should be recorded for later access to
43 * functions provided by the framework.
45 * This function MUST return the address of a structure that describes
46 * the binding and its implemented verbs.
48 * In case of initialisation error, NULL must be returned.
50 * Be aware that the given 'interface' is not fully functionnal
51 * because no provision is given to the name and description
52 * of the binding. Check the function 'afbBindingV1ServiceInit'
53 * defined in the file <afb/afb-service-v1.h> because when
54 * the function 'afbBindingV1ServiceInit' is called, the 'interface'
55 * is fully functionnal.
57 extern const struct afb_binding_v1 *afbBindingV1Register (const struct afb_binding_interface_v1 *interface);
60 * When a binding have an exported implementation of the
61 * function 'afbBindingV1ServiceInit', defined below,
62 * the framework calls it for initialising the service after
63 * registration of all bindings.
65 * The object 'service' should be recorded. It has functions that
66 * allows the binding to call features with its own personality.
